The Historic Hotel du Cap-Eden-Roc Celebrates Its Centennial

In 1914, the Hotel du Cap-Eden-Roc along the waterfront in Cap d’Antibes, France, created its now famous Eden-Roc Pavilion seawater swimming pool. The historic hotel—which inspired F. Scott Fitzgerald’s Tender Is the Night and was a hangout for Pablo Picasso, Marc Chagall, and many other artists—is now celebrating the Pavilion’s 100th anniversary with a lineup of festivities from May through September.
